Giacom ‘solidifies Microsoft licensing leadership’ with intY buy

ScanSource offloads UK Microsoft licensing specialist four years after acquiring it

Giacom claims it has “solidified” its leadership in the UK Microsoft licensing space after snapping up fellow cloud marketplace intY from its US parent.

NASDAQ-listed distributor ScanSource acquired Bristol-based intY in 2019, branding its CASCADE cloud platform “the next piece in our continuing digital strategy”.

Its decision to offload intY to one of its key UK peers mean ScanSource no longer has representation in the UK (it sold its UK comms business in 2020).

Giacom said the move will strengthen its position as “the largest and most technically proficient provider of Microsoft licensing to the SMB-focused channel”.

Notching up revenues of £51.3m in its fiscal 2022, intY ranked 24th in IT Channel Oxygen’s recent UK distribution rundown.

Giacom placed ninth, with revenues of £360m (£120m of which came from cloud).

The cloud distribution market has seen considerable action in recent years, with US cloud marketplace Pax8 building a 400-employee UK/EMEA business since touching down in 2020.

Giacom was itself acquired in 2020 by Digital Wholesale Solutions (before the wider company took the Giacom name this summer).

Giacom said the acquisition – which includes IntY’s UK revenues, 1,500 partners and business operations – not only solidifies its “leadership” in Microsoft licensing, but “also presents an exciting cross-sell opportunity”.

“The integration of intY’s expertise and capabilities will strengthen our ability to support partners in this critical growth sector of the market, while further establishing Giacom as the go-to provider for Microsoft cloud services to the SMB-focused UK channel,” Giacom CEO Terry O’Brien said in a prepared statement.

Marcus Ollenbuttel, SVP, Digital Distribution, Europe, intY, characterised “Giacom as “a business that intY has long admired as a best-of-breed UK-focused peer that shares our commitment to working exclusively through the channel”.

“We’re excited to become part of the Giacom team. We look forward to a seamless integration process, and to the transformative impact this acquisition will have on our ability to not only support our partners but to add increasing value to them moving forwards,” he added.
